2 tablespoons chopped onion
1 beaten egg yolk
½ teaspoon steak seasoning
½ pound ground turkey
8 slices whole grain bread
24 (½ inch) cubes Cabot Sharp Lite75 Cheddar (about 4 ounces)
Optional garnishes: dill pickle slices, catsup, mustard and green onions
PREHEAT broiler.
COMBINE onion, yolk and steak seasoning in a medium bowl. Crumble turkey over mixture and mix well. Shape by teaspoonfuls into 24 balls; set aside.
REMOVE crusts from bread. Roll flat and cut into 1 ½ inch rounds; set aside.
MAKE depression in each turkey ball and fill with cube of cheese. Place turkey balls, cheese-side-down, onto bread rounds. Press ball onto bread, making sure bread is covered with turkey ball. Seal edges.
PLACE on baking sheet. Broil about 6 inches from heat for 3 to 5 minutes or until turkey is no longer pink. Garnish as desired and serve.
